We hope everyone had a good January of birding. With the month ending
we have a couple of things to cover.
First, anyone with a total of at least 90 species seen in Connecticut
in January is invited to send their totals and in a week or ten days
we will post the numbers and names. No, we don't need the list of
species, just the count.
Second, now that we don't need to provide information on anything a
little unusual to help those trying for a good January, we will be
going back to following the standard rules and not reporting birds on
the Common Birds list. So no more Flickers and Catbirds for now. The
list can be found at:

From Frank Mantlik:
1/31 - Stratford, Rt. 113, Sikorsky Airport -- MERLIN, 22 BOAT-TAILED
GRACKLES at 7am
Stratford, Oak Bluff Ave., Long Beach -- 1st-winter ICELAND GULL
continues
Stratford, Short Beach saltpond -- 138 GADWALL
Milford, Oronoque Rd., Waste Transfer Station -- hundreds of gulls
including 1st-winter ICELAND GULL.
Milford, Caswell Cove -- 9 RUDDY DUCKS
1/30 Westport, Compo Beach - 1 adult NORTHERN GANNET
From Rollin S. Tebbetts:
1/31 -Bradley International Airport -- PEREGRINE FALCON. I was able
to read her left leg band...she is the same bird I observed on
November 4, 2005 at the airport. She was banded on May 20, 1994 at
the Riverside Church, upper west side of Manhattan, NY.
From Paula Verderame:
1/30 - Madison, Hammonasset State Park -- LAZULI BUNTING 11:15 a.m.
The bird was approximately halfway between the Rotary and the East
Beach parking area along the main road in the pines closer to the
Rotary. It was alone and not with either the flock of Savannahs or the
flock of mixed sparrows and Cardinals by the East Beach parking area.
From Steve Broker:
1/30 - Hamden, intersection of Dixwell Avenue and Wilbur Cross Parkway
-- GREAT EGRET flying west at 3:10 P.M..
From Angela Dimmitt with Anne Kehmna and Carol Titus
1/31 - Stratford/Long Beach - 1st winter ICELAND GULL
Frash Pond - GREAT CORMORANT
